Remote Fobs

The key fob is a small remote that you can attach to your keychain. It can open your trunk and doors and, sometimes, even starts your vehicle. They come in a variety of shapes and sizes, with varying capabilities. They all function in the same way that is, when you press one of the buttons on the fob it transmits an audio signal that is accompanied by an unique code to a receiver inside your car, which performs the function you requested. This includes unlocking the doors and locking them, as well as lowering and raising your roof or sunroof, and starting the engine.

A lot of cars have a button that can lower all the windows simultaneously which is useful when parking. However, if your key fob is accidentally triggered while in the bottom of your purse or in your pants pocket, the windows can become wide open, which happened to one Consumer Reports auto editor who was walking out to her Honda Accord and found all the windows down and the sunroof opened.

Transponder Chips

It is likely that if you own a Renault Clio, your key will have transponder. These chips are present in all modern cars and are a fantastic security measure. Transponder keys are programmed to open the vehicle in a specific way and cannot be duplicated without a valid code. This makes them extremely difficult to take and is a major reason they are extremely effective in stopping auto theft.

A transponder, also known as a tiny computer chip, sends an unintentional radio signal when activated by a car's ignition. The immobilizer scans the signals on a regular basis and disable the engine if a match is detected. If the car is stolen and someone attempts to start it using the key you used to open it the immobilizer will prevent the car from starting.
